Iranian Foreign Ministry spokesman Esmaeil Baghaei said that the exchange of messages with the United States via Pakistan continues.

He added, “Multiple messages have been exchanged since the Iranian delegation returned from Pakistan,” noting that it is highly likely Iran will host a Pakistani delegation on Wednesday to continue the talks.

He added, “The talks with Pakistan will address a complete end to the war, the lifting of sanctions, and compensation for the damage caused by U.S. and Israeli attacks on Iran.” Reuters
